Blue Chip Stock #8 – Petroleo Brasileiro (PBR; +800%)
Ok, so Brazil’s energy giant Petrobras (PBR) wasn’t officially listed on the NYSE until August of 2000, but considering shares debuted at $5.25 and are now at almost $50, I consider this stock one of the standout blue chips of the decade. Petroleo Brasileiro engages in oil and gas exploration and production, with proven reserves of over 15 billion barrels of oil. Crude prices creeped up 75% across 2009, and are now pushing $80 a barrel. I expect energy prices to get even higher in the new year and deliver big profits to companies like PBR.
